We will begin with the sound of the bell to call us back home to our breathe. We will determine as a group what it means to be mindful and how it serves us and others around us. We will practice a guided meditation that asks us to imagine ourselves as different elements of nature, which will allow us to 1) instill in us beneficial characteristics of the earth and 2) connect to the earth, honoring our inter-being. For example, in meditation we will imagine ourselves as a mountain, the students will feel what it is like to be strong and stable as a mountain, while not being rigid or closed off, but open to things like water, which flows along its crevices, and connected to the sky, which shares its space. Such an exercise is meant to encourage the capacity for strength, stability, fluidity, joy, and connection in the spirit of the student. The student will receive a copy of the meditation script to use whenever they are feeling defeated or disconnected.
